## Admin Dashboard 7.3.0 — rotation notice

Dark-mode support (Gloamline theme) shipped in this build; no auth-surface changes. Concurrent scheduled rotation of the dashboard's release signing credential performed per the Verrow security calendar. Prior key revoked, CRL published internally. All 7.3.x artifacts signed with the new credential; 7.2.x artifacts remain valid until end of support. Reviewer action: confirm revocation propagated to build verifiers. New signing key follows.

rollout seal: bky4_x7Gc

Subject: GraphLattice cut-over done

Team,

The dependency graph visualizer now runs on the Verdan cluster. Old renderer at Holmsk is decommissioned; no rollback path remains after Friday. Edge caching is on by default, layout workers scaled to four. Watch memory on the traversal pods for the first week. For future maintainers: the active service configuration at cut-over is recorded below.

settings of yaguf-bahip:
druwyn:
  log_level: debug
  metrics_host: metrics.druwyn.qorvelsys.internal
  pool_size: 32

**Ticket BLW-917: Blue-green cutover stalls billing worker plugins**

During the last blue-green deploy of the Corvette billing worker, plugins holding long-poll connections to the green pool were dropped without a drain signal. External plugins should implement the new `on_drain` callback before the next rollout window. Reproduction steps are attached; the relevant deploy token follows below.

pipeline stamp: htk3_cc5